Read this description of the life cycle of a mushroom. 1. A mushroom begins to grow underground as a single-celled "spore.” 2. The spore grows into multicellular structures called "hyphae.” 3. The hyphae absorb nutrition and detect when conditions are right to sprout a mushroom above ground. 4. The sprouted mushroom then forms new spores that can enter the ground and begin the life cycle again. Which sentence about this life cycle shows that mushrooms need energy and respond to stimuli? A: A mushroom begins to grow underground as a single-celled “spore.” B: The spore grows into multicellular structures called “hyphae.” C: The hyphae absorb nutrition and detect when conditions are right to sprout a mushroom above ground. D: The sprouted mushroom then forms new spores that can enter the ground and begin the life cycle again
